CO-sTiRNA + checkpoint inhibitors + CAR-Ts is a combination immunotherapy regimen being developed by Scopus BioPharma in collaboration with City of Hope. The core component, CO-sTiRNA (also known as CpG-STAT3siRNA), is a first-in-class targeted gene therapy that combines a STAT3-targeting small interfering RNA (siRNA) with a CpG oligonucleotide TLR9 agonist. This dual-action molecule is designed to silence the immunosuppressive STAT3 gene while simultaneously activating the innate immune system via TLR9. When used in combination with immune checkpoint inhibitors (such as PD-1/PD-L1 or CTLA-4 blockers) and chimeric antigen receptor T-cells (CAR-Ts), the regimen aims to overcome the immunosuppressive tumor microenvironment and enhance the persistence and efficacy of adoptive cell therapies. It is currently in preclinical development for B-cell non-Hodgkin's lymphoma, cutaneous T-cell lymphoma, and various solid tumors.
